Skip to content

Conversation

@immrsd
Copy link
Collaborator

@immrsd immrsd commented Dec 23, 2025

Summary by CodeRabbit

  • Chores
    • Updated testing framework dependency to the latest version for improved stability and features.
    • Updated changelog to reflect the dependency version upgrade.

✏️ Tip: You can customize this high-level summary in your review settings.

@immrsd immrsd self-assigned this Dec 23, 2025
@coderabbitai
Copy link

coderabbitai bot commented Dec 23, 2025

Walkthrough

A routine dependency version upgrade updates snforge_std from 0.53.0 to 0.54.1 in the workspace configuration, with a corresponding changelog entry documenting the bump.

Changes

Cohort / File(s) Summary
Dependency Update
Scarb.toml
Updated workspace dependency snforge_std from version 0.53.0 to 0.54.1
Changelog Entry
packages/testing/CHANGELOG.md
Added unreleased changelog entry for "Bump snforge to v0.54.1 (#1621)"

Estimated code review effort

🎯 1 (Trivial) | ⏱️ ~2 minutes

Poem

🐰 A version hop, so clean and bright,
snforge bumps to 0.54.1's light,
With changelog neat and dependencies true,
The warren's ready for what's new! ✨

Pre-merge checks and finishing touches

✅ Passed checks (3 passed)
Check name Status Explanation
Description Check ✅ Passed Check skipped - CodeRabbit’s high-level summary is enabled.
Title check ✅ Passed The pull request title directly matches the main change: updating the snforge_std dependency from 0.53.0 to 0.54.1, which is clearly reflected in both the Scarb.toml and CHANGELOG.md updates.
Docstring Coverage ✅ Passed No functions found in the changed files to evaluate docstring coverage. Skipping docstring coverage check.
✨ Finishing touches
🧪 Generate unit tests (beta)
  • Create PR with unit tests
  • Post copyable unit tests in a comment
  • Commit unit tests in branch feat/bump-foundry-to-0.54.1

📜 Recent review details

Configuration used: Organization UI

Review profile: CHILL

Plan: Pro

📥 Commits

Reviewing files that changed from the base of the PR and between 4ed98e8 and 49015b5.

⛔ Files ignored due to path filters (1)
  • Scarb.lock is excluded by !**/*.lock
📒 Files selected for processing (2)
  • Scarb.toml
  • packages/testing/CHANGELOG.md
⏰ Context from checks skipped due to timeout of 90000ms. You can increase the timeout in your CodeRabbit configuration to a maximum of 15 minutes (900000ms). (3)
  • GitHub Check: Lint and test macros
  • GitHub Check: comment-benchmark-diff
  • GitHub Check: Lint and test Cairo
🔇 Additional comments (2)
packages/testing/CHANGELOG.md (1)

12-13: LGTM!

The changelog entry is correctly formatted and placed in the Unreleased section, matching the version bump in Scarb.toml.

Scarb.toml (1)

48-48: snforge_std 0.54.1 is compatible with Cairo 2.13.1 and Scarb 2.13.1.

Verification confirms compatibility. Scarb v2.13.1 ships with Cairo v2.13.1, and snforge_std 0.54.1 maintains compatibility without breaking changes. No security advisories were identified.


Comment @coderabbitai help to get the list of available commands and usage tips.

@github-actions
Copy link
Contributor

github-actions bot commented Dec 23, 2025

🧪 Cairo Contract Size Benchmark Diff

BYTECODE SIZE (felts) (limit: 81,920 felts)

No changes in felts.

SIERRA CONTRACT CLASS SIZE (bytes) (limit: 4,089,446 bytes)

No changes in bytes.

This comment was generated automatically from benchmark diffs.

@codecov
Copy link

codecov bot commented Dec 23, 2025

Codecov Report

✅ All modified and coverable lines are covered by tests.
✅ Project coverage is 92.57%. Comparing base (4ed98e8) to head (49015b5).
⚠️ Report is 1 commits behind head on main.

Additional details and impacted files
@@            Coverage Diff             @@
##             main    #1621      +/-   ##
==========================================
+ Coverage   92.36%   92.57%   +0.20%     
==========================================
  Files          85       85              
  Lines        2278     2275       -3     
==========================================
+ Hits         2104     2106       +2     
+ Misses        174      169       -5     

see 4 files with indirect coverage changes


Continue to review full report in Codecov by Sentry.

Legend - Click here to learn more
Δ = absolute <relative> (impact), ø = not affected, ? = missing data
Powered by Codecov. Last update 4ed98e8...49015b5. Read the comment docs.

🚀 New features to boost your workflow:
  • ❄️ Test Analytics: Detect flaky tests, report on failures, and find test suite problems.

Copy link
Member

@ericnordelo ericnordelo left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M!

@immrsd immrsd merged commit 454b63c into main Dec 24, 2025
12 checks passed
This was referenced Dec 24,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ants